FreeOCR is a free open source optical character recognition software for Windows that can extract text from images, such as scanned documents and photos. It can convert these images to a number of editable formats such as doc, txt, and pdf.

goormIDE is a cloud-based integrated development environment that allows developers to code online without installing anything on their computer. It supports various languages and frameworks and provides features like debugging, version control, and collaboration.
